English: Employment up 105,000 compared with the previous quarter
Comparing November 2013-January 2014 with the previous three months, there was a rise in the number of employed people, and a fall in the number of people who were unemployed. The number of people not in the labour force fell slightly. Comparing November 2013 to January 2014 with the previous three months, the number of people in employment increased by 105,000 (to reach 30.19 million), the number of unemployed people fell by 63,000 (to reach 2.33 million) and the number of people not in the labour force (economically inactive) aged from 16 to 64 fell by 19,000 (to reach 8.90 million). Compared with a year earlier, for both men and women, employment is higher and unemployment is lower. For November 2013-January 2014, 77.3% of men aged from 16 to 64 were in work, up from 76.5% a year earlier and 75.4% two years earlier, but lower than before the 2008-09 downturn. For November 2013-January 2014, 67.2% of women aged from 16 to 64 were in work, up from 66.6% a year earlier and 65.4% two years earlier. For November 2013-January 2014, 7.4% of men in the labour force were unemployed, down from 8.2% a year earlier and 8.9% two years earlier, but higher than before the 2008-09 downturn. For November 2013-January 2014, 6.9% of women in the labour force were unemployed, down from 7.3% a year earlier and 7.6% two years earlier, but higher than before the 2008-09 downturn. For November 2013-January 2014, 16.4% of men aged from 16 to 64 were not in the labour force, unchanged from a year earlier but down from 17.1% two years earlier. For November 2013-January 2014, 27.7% of women aged from 16 to 64 were not in the labour force, down from 28.1% a year earlier and 29.0% two years earlier. Since records began in 1971 the percentage of women aged from 16 to 64 not in the labour force has been gradually falling while the percentage of men aged from 16 to 64 not in the labour force has been gradually rising. http://www.ons.gov.uk/ons/rel/lms/labour-market-statistics/march-2014/sty-employment.html |
